
Horned Frogs Remain Second At MWC Championship
4/17/2009 12:00:00 AM | Women's Golf
April 17, 2009
SEASIDE, Calif. -- TCU shot a 302 and is in second place, nine shots back of New Mexico, after Friday's second round of the Mountain West Conference Women's Golf Championship.
The Horned Frogs lowered their team score by three shots from Thursday's opening round but lost ground to the Lobos, who carded a 297 and are at 598 for 36 holes. TCU is at 607. BYU is in third place, 11 strokes behind the Frogs.
TCU freshman Brooke Beeler had a 1-over-par 73 and is tied for third individually at 148. The Butler, Ill., native is three shots behind leader Jonelle Martinez of Wyoming who is at 145. Martinez holds a two-stroke advantage over New Mexico's Jodi Ewart.
For the second straight day, TCU's Rachel Raastad and Valentine Derrey posted identical scores. Their second-round 76s have them tied for 10th at 153.
Allyson Ferguson had a 77 for TCU and tied Beeler and Prisela Campbell for team-high honors with two birdies.
